PROBe
PROBe
command/query
The
:CHANNEL
<
N
>
:PROBE
command
specifies
the
probe
attenuation factor
for
the
selected
channel.
The
range
of
the
probe
attenuation factor
is
from
0.9
to
1000.0.
This
command
does
not
change
the
actual
input
sensitivity
of
the
HP
54501A. It
changes
the
reference
constants
for
scaling
the
display
factors
and
for
automatic
measurements,
trigger levels,
etc.
The
PROBE
query returns
the
current
probe
attenuation
factor for
the
selected
channel.
